Output 43d214719491db579daf085a85166d2b039e4d1fe43672a00dbfb2d57f41c77c:13

value
170858545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e181acbdd145488711d3d31207f58d7371313a96 OP_EQUAL
address
MUTXcZ2tnDzs1VZKUn3BNtynFxddMEAT1v
transaction
43d214719491db579daf085a85166d2b039e4d1fe43672a00dbfb2d57f41c77c
spent
true